Landline services for all providers are going through a Digital Switchover process over the next few years. By 2025 all landines will be internet based, & hence plug directly into a Broadband hub rather than a seperate socket. You can have your master socket wired to the hub if you wish, but in most cases this will leave an exposed trailing wire between the two. The other option is DECT cordless handsets which are completely portable around the home.
